Address Field Inventory for instance, comes with an array of tasks to help you create an address layer based on a list or verified sites that are collected via an online form. The feature layers can be used to generate USNG coordinates as well as a mailing address. Additionally this solution allows you to divide roads at a specified point, calculate municipal boundaries, and update address characteristics in the master road name table.
Another illustration of an Esri solution is Managing Address Field Operations, designed to assist address authorities collect incorrect or missing address information from external and internal stakeholders. It enables office personnel to assign tasks to their field workers, who use the address crowdsourcing tool using their mobile devices to verify submitted addresses and record any new ones observed while in the field. This information is then added to the appropriate databases for further processing and publication.
The solution also permits office personnel to assign a task the option to validate an existing set of address information using a specific accuracy threshold, which helps them identify errors such as duplicates and incorrect addresses in the database. This information can then be transferred into the master address database to enhance data quality and make the database more accurate.
Reverse Geocode Geoprocessing Tool
Reverse geocoding can be used to understand data, whether you're trying to find the location of a company or simply want to know which areas are most profitable. Many mobile apps, including Uber or Lyft, rely on reverse geocoding to convert raw GPS coordinates into something drivers can read. Retail chains use reverse geocoding to understand their customers' buying habits. Urban planners are able to connect address data with population density to determine the best location to construct public infrastructure.
The Reverse Geocode tool turns point locations within a feature class into addresses by searching for the nearest intersection or address based upon the distance of search. It can be used to reverse geocode single points or multiple points in batches. Its output is organized and ready to be integrated into other systems and tools.
It can handle both custom and 링크모음 (Scientific-Programs.science) standard formats of address data, including the standard attributes X, Y of a Point Address feature, as well as the IDs for POIs (Point of Interest). You can also specify the location type of the geometry you are comparing to -- it could be a routing area that is a street side location that can be used to route, or the rooftop or parcel centroid of an address.
Additionally you can use the tool to create a composite locator by connecting two or more existing locators together. If it fails to find the address using the local information, the resulting locator will fallback on ArcGIS World Geocoding.

Data Validation Tool
A reliable tool to verify addresses is a powerful tool that helps businesses maintain data accuracy and operational efficiency. It ensures that mail gets to the correct location and that invoices are delivered to the correct customer, and marketing campaigns reach their intended target audience, thereby driving precision in delivery systems and improving overall satisfaction of users. When selecting a validation tool make sure you choose one that has extensive coverage of all countries and seamless integration into business processes. You should also think about pricing structures and choose tools with a high ROI.
It is important to ensure that the initial data entry of addresses is accurate whether it's written on paper forms in stores, or entered digitally during an online check-out or integrating data from CRM systems. This will reduce shipping errors and returns and ultimately improve customer satisfaction and loyalty. This requires more than just using a standard postal code or ZIP code lookup; it requires a process of thorough address verification and collection.
This process begins with an advanced data parsing tool that breaks down an address into its various components, including the street name, city name, and postal code. The tool then matches these pieces with commercial databases to validate their accuracy. The tool then standardizes the address to be in line with the global postal standards. For example, it converts extended forms into standard abbreviations or capitalization.
The address is then geocoded to verify its location. This is particularly important for companies that operate globally. It lets them estimate shipping costs accurately and provide transparency for 링크모음사이트 customers, reducing the risk of costly delays due to inaccurate or insufficient information. A robust geocoding API will also help businesses comply with international shipping regulations and avoid customs issues.
Once the address has been verified, it's updated automatically in CRM systems and enterprise resource planning systems, ensuring that every customer interaction or shipment delivery is based on accurate information. Accurate information on addresses can also help streamline operations in the logistical field by simplifying logistics, procurement and delivery of services.
